ODM Announces Month-Long Raila Tribute, Reveals Major Events Across Kenya

Share
Raila Odinga profile background.

The Orange Democratic Movement (ODM) has announced a month-long programme to commemorate the late former party leader Raila Amolo Odinga, one year after his death.

In a statement issued on Thursday, September 10, 2026, ODM said it will dedicate the entire month of October to honouring Raila and remembering his contribution to Kenya’s democracy and Pan-Africanism.

The party has named the programme “Mwezi wa Baba”, in reference to Raila’s popular title, Baba.

Raila Odinga’s Candle-Lighting Ceremony

ODM will kick off the commemorations on October 2 with a nationwide candle-lighting ceremony. The party has asked Kenyans to light candles at 6 pm, either individually or in organised groups, to remember Raila.

ODM described Raila’s death as a painful moment for the party and the country. “It was a tearful moment; we were all heartbroken. God plucked the best flower from our midst,” the party said.

Memorial Rally in Kakamega

On October 9, ODM will hold a major memorial rally in Kakamega Town. The event will bring together party supporters from counties across the Western Kenya region, including Kakamega, Vihiga, Busia, Bungoma and Trans Nzoia.

From October 10 to 15, the party said family-led activities will take place before culminating in the main memorial service at Kang’o Ka Jaramogi in Bondo.

Activities Planned Across the Country 

ODM will then take the commemorations to different regions. On October 17, the party will hold a memorial rally in Garissa Town, bringing together supporters from Garissa, Wajir, Mandera, Isiolo and Marsabit counties.

The Coastal region will host memorial activities from October 18 to 19, followed by Mashujaa Day celebrations on October 20.

The party will hold further memorial activities in Kajiado County on October 21.

Turkana and Nairobi Events

ODM has scheduled memorial activities in Turkana County from October 23 to 25.

The month-long programme will end with the “Mwezi wa Baba” memorial rally in Nairobi County on October 31.

The party urged its supporters to use the month to reflect on Raila’s legacy and strengthen their commitment to the ideals he stood for.

“We urge all our supporters to rededicate their commitment to BABA’S ideals,” ODM said.

The party then wished blessings upon ODM and Kenya, saying, “God Bless ODM. God Bless Kenya.”
